My first suggestion is the Hektor Villa-Lobas "Bachianas Brasileiras No. 5" for guitar and soprano voice. You would, or course, play the soprano voice part on trombone. It doesn't have lyrics, just vocalizing. There may be other Villa-Lobos pieces that can be adapted. Check with your guitarist. If they're good enough to play the Villa-Lobos they should know of other repertoire that features guitar plus 1.
